RaceFace Atlas Crankset – 165mm Direct Mount RaceFace CINCH Spindle Interface Black. The Race Face Atlas crank is the burliest alloy CINCH offering; designed to excel across many disciplines including trail enduro DH and freeride. Featuring the versatile CINCH interface for interchangeable spiders limitless ring combinations a 30mm alloy spindle and compatibility across all relevant frame standards.

  • Crank arms forged from 7050 aluminum with a bracing matrix for added stiffness
  • Compatible with all CINCH direct mount rings and spiders to easily convert between existing chainring standards including: direct mount 1x 2x with and without bash and 3x configurations
  • CINCH removable spiders and direct mount rings utilize a 20-tooth ISIS cup BB tool for removal and installation
  • 30mm spline interface CNCd from aluminum super alloy
